Hidden costs that actually matter
- Wagering multiplier: 30× on a $10 bonus = $300 necessary turnover.
- Maximum cash‑out: $5 on a $20 spin package = 25% of potential earnings.
- Withdrawal fee: $2.50 per transaction, which erodes a $7 win by 36%.
Because every time you think you’ve beaten the system, the casino throws in a $1.99 admin charge, turning a $15 win into a $13.01 net profit.

Practical steps to avoid the fluff
First, write down the exact bonus amount and multiply by the wagering requirement; the result is the minimum you must risk to cash out.
Second, compare that figure with the average return of a low‑variance slot like Book of Dead; if the required turnover exceeds $200, the bonus is practically a trap.
Third, check the “max win” clause; a $10 bonus with a $5 max win is a 50% conversion rate—hardly worth the effort.
